Thermal regimes in impact melts and the petrology of the Apollo 17 Station 6 boulder

C. H. Simonds

Open full text 52 citations

Abstract

This paper is a progress report on the petrologic study of the Station 6 boulder, with a discussion of the implications of its petrographic and geochemical studies to the understanding of the processes of formation and crystallization of impact melts.
